  • Compliance Training

Compliance issues are a typical incidence in the pharmaceutical sector, and such issues occur primarily due to:

  1. Lack of clearly defined procedures and SOPs
  2. Not-having real-time access to data
  3. Lack of communication and collaboration

Adding to the challenge, the company must keep up with government-issued product standards and guidelines, which are constantly changing. 

Instructional information for a given topic expires when government laws for that product change. If you don’t retrain your staff on the new process, your company risks falling out of compliance.

It is also necessary to record and document all pharma compliance training for the purpose of conducting extensive audits.

  • Onboarding New Employees

Reports say “The Pharma industry crossed the worldwide revenue of 1.27 trillion dollars in 2020.”

Also, according to the Indian Economic Survey 2021, “the domestic market is expected to grow 3x in the next decade. India’s domestic pharmaceutical market is at US$ 42 billion in 2021 and likely to reach US$ 65 billion by 2024 and further expand to reach ~US$ 120-130 billion by 2030.”

At this rate of expansion, the pharmaceutical business must hire additional employees to keep up with the demands.

Along with hiring you also need an appropriate solution to train staff in distinct teams, such as production areas, control laboratories, quality assurance, regulatory affairs, maintenance, stores, sanitation, and safety.

  • Tracking and Reporting

A Learning Management System measures and monitors employee learning progress, and the results are presented in the form of built-in or customized reporting formats. 

Companies can generate comprehensive reports on the user’s progress with just a few clicks. This facilitates doing a gap analysis of planned and completed training for employees easily.

The LMS can be set up to generate reports on a regular basis and to give an audit trail to help you fulfill all of your auditing requirements.

Reporting and analytics can be utilized to evaluate learning effectiveness based on course completions, quiz results, and milestones met, as well as to determine whether extra training is needed. Again, auditable records of these evaluations are available at all times.
